Neil Gorsuch

Neil Gorsuch

Neil Gorsuch, born on August 29, 1967, is an Associate Justice of the Supreme Court of the United States. He graduated from Harvard University and Oxford University, and served as a judge on the United States Court of Appeals for the Tenth Circuit before being appointed to the Supreme Court by President Donald Trump, known for his conservative judicial philosophy and strict interpretation of constitutional originalism.

Patrick Leahy

Patrick Leahy

Patrick Leahy (born March 31, 1940) is an American politician who served as a United States Senator from Vermont from 1975 to 2023. A member of the Democratic Party, he was the longest-serving current senator and the last remaining senator from the Vietnam War era. Leahy chaired the Senate Judiciary Committee and served on the Appropriations Committee, championing civil rights, environmental protection, and judicial reform. He authored key legislation including the Leahy-Smith America Invents Act and the Leahy Act for wetland protection. Known for bipartisanship, he also gained attention as a photographer and comic book collector. Upon retirement, he left a legacy of legislative achievement and institutional stability.
